The microwave oven suddenly broke down!

1. There is no response when power is applied, and the safety tube is in good condition.

Mechanically controlled microwave oven: mechanical timer and magnetron temperature limiter can be checked. Computer-controlled microwave oven: observe the safety tube of the computer board, and check the power transformer and magnetron temperature limit protector on the computer board. After troubleshooting, the safety tube tester can be replaced.

2. There is no response when the power is turned on, and the fuse is blown.

Check the door switch, microwave high voltage system (high voltage transformer, high voltage diode, magnetron and high voltage capacitor), fan motor and turntable motor. After troubleshooting, the safety tube tester can be replaced.

Check the high-voltage transformer mainly to observe whether the primary winding and high-voltage winding are burnt or not, and whether the insulating paint is burnt or not.

3. Burn the power fuse repeatedly

Check the door switch and high-voltage transformer first, and then check other devices in the microwave system, such as high-voltage diodes, high-voltage capacitors, bidirectional diodes, magnetrons, etc.

It can run, but the microwave oven is not heated.

Firstly, whether there is power supply on the primary side of high voltage transformer is measured, and then the maintenance range is determined according to the measurement results. If it is measured that there is no AC220V power supply in the primary of the high voltage transformer, the microwave oven is mechanically controlled, so check the timer and door switch; When the computer controls the microwave oven, check the door switch, computer board fire relay and drive transistor. If AC220V power supply is detected at the primary of the high voltage transformer, check the high voltage transformer, high voltage fuse, high voltage diode and protection diode.

If the microwave oven is not heated, the noise will increase or the vibration will be great. Focus on microwave systems, such as high-voltage diodes, high-voltage transformers, high-voltage capacitors, bidirectional diodes, magnetrons, etc.

6. Microwave heating is slow, and the firepower is obviously less than before. This kind of fault is usually the aging of magnetron, and a few are the poor contact of power control selector switch or power relay.

7. If the barbecue grill is not heated, check whether the barbecue grill has AC220V power supply. If the power supply is normal, replace the barbecue tube; If there is no power supply voltage, check the barbecue control circuit, such as barbecue temperature limit protector and barbecue switch. For computer-controlled microwave ovens, check the barbecue relay and drive transistor.

8. After starting the machine, the inner container is ignited. Under the condition of confirming that the user has never used metal utensils, check whether the mica sheet is burnt and whether the inner container is too wet.

9. Start or stop key failure

Generally found in computer-controlled microwave ovens, check the membrane switch.

1 1. Sometimes it doesn't start, sometimes it automatically switches functions, and the buzzer rings by mistake.

Measure the +5V, reset and clock oscillation pin voltages of CPU, and replace the crystal.

12. Tray does not work

Check the pallet synchronous motor and its power supply voltage when the shaft and track are normal.

13. The fan motor does not work.

Check the fan motor and power supply.

14. After opening the oven door, the motor of the oven panel still rotates.

Computer-controlled microwave oven, check the main relay and control transistor on the computer board; Mechanically control the microwave oven and check the oven door switch.

15. Without stopping the heating of the mechanical microwave oven, check whether the timing motor is damaged, whether the rotating shaft of the timing button adheres to the panel, and whether the power supply of the timing motor is normal.

Timer motors can be divided into AC220V and AC50V. If the fan motor is damaged, the timer motor will stall.
